One of the most common issues with steel doors is sagging or misaligned hinges. This can happen over time due to wear and tear, incorrect installation, or excessive force being applied to the door. To repair sagging hinges, start by removing the door from its frame and inspecting the hinges for any damage. If the hinges are worn out or damaged, they will need to be replaced. Make sure to use the correct size and type of hinges for your steel door to ensure a proper fit and smooth operation.

If your steel door is sticking or rubbing against the frame, it may be due to a misaligned door or frame. To fix this issue, loosen the screws on the hinges and adjust the door until it is properly aligned with the frame. Once the door is in the correct position, tighten the screws to secure it in place. If the door continues to stick or rub, you may need to remove some material from the door or frame to create more clearance.

Another common steel door repair issue is a malfunctioning lock or latch. If your door is difficult to lock or unlock, it may be due to a problem with the lock mechanism. Start by inspecting the lock to ensure that it is not damaged or clogged with debris. You may need to lubricate the lock with a silicone-based lubricant to help it operate smoothly. If the lock is still not functioning properly, you may need to replace it with a new one.

If your steel door has dents or scratches, you can repair them using a few simple tools and techniques. Start by cleaning the damaged area with a mild detergent and water to remove any dirt or debris. Use a hammer and dolly to gently tap out the dents from the inside of the door. If the dent is too deep to repair with this method, you may need to fill it with an auto body filler and sand it smooth. For scratches, you can touch up the paint with a matching color to blend in the repair.
